Background

The opening track of Lover signals an immediate tonal shift from reputation. Co-produced with Joel Little, the song was written as Taylor emerged from the reputation era and realized the feuds that once consumed her simply no longer mattered.

Meaning & Interpretation

The song is about the liberating moment when someone who once occupied all your emotional bandwidth just stops mattering. Taylor frames indifference — not anger, not forgiveness, but genuine disinterest — as the ultimate form of moving on. The breezy, almost casual delivery is the point: this is what it sounds like when you are actually over it.

Personal Connection

The track functions as a thesis statement for the Lover era, declaring that the reputation chapter is closed and Taylor has arrived somewhere lighter and freer.
